Cerro Arrojata
Cerro Arrojata is a peak in Municipio Sucre, Venezuela and has an elevation of 575 metres. Cerro Arrojata is situated nearby to the town Barbacoas, as well as near the village Plan de la Mesa.| Tap on a place to explore it |
